Description
A large group of people ready for the PRIDE Parade and Festival held at Turner Park in Omaha, Nebraska holding banners "We Are Everywhere", "Presbyterians for Lesbian/Gay Concerns", "Imperial Court of Nebraska", and signs "Open the Door to the (drawing of) closet", "Silence = Death," "My Mother LOVES Me, My Father LOVES Me, Why Can't You Just Accept Me?" and more.
